SLC to offer matching rights to IPG after term ends

Sri Lanka Cricket(SLC) has decided to offer matching rights for the current event right holder of the Lanka Premier League (LPL) at the end of the current five-year term, if they are willing to pay 25% more than the highest bid. At the conclusion of the existing contract, the board has decided to call for tenders with matching rights to the current rights holder.

The Dubai-based company– The IPG Group, the current LPL event right holder, has requested for five years of matching rights for the tournament at the conclusion of the current five-year contract to recover their investment citing huge losses totaling to US$2.4 million from the first year itself.
